Catheter Urinary Tract Infection (CAUTI)
Urinary tract infection (UTI) is a common infection in the nursing homes. They are mostly associated with the indwelling urinary catheters. In a report published by CDC’s National Healthcare Safety Network (NHSN), UTI is the most common type of the hospital acquired infection. 75% of the UTIs acquired in hospital are usually associated with the catheter which is a tube inserted into the bladder through the urethra in order to drain urine (Clarke & Tong, 2014). This infection is common in a number of nursing homes and it is approximated that up to 10% of the nursing homes residents will experience and indwelling urinary catheter during their stay ant the nursing homes (Meddings, Manojlovich, & Ameling, 2019). Even though prevalence for CAUTI is low in the nursing homes than in an acute care setting, the duration of stay appears to be longer in these nursing homes than in the acute setting. Some of the interventions that have been put in place to reduce infection in the acute setting may not also be appropriate in the nursing homes. Given that the risk of developing CAUTI is associated with the longer duration of stay at the indwelling catheter placement, the most effective way of reducing CAUTI is by only making sure that placement takes place only for instances where it is necessary and looking for interventions of reducing or limiting the placement time to the shortest time. The goal of the proposed intervention is to reduce the infection rate of CAUTI.
Proposed Solution
The implementation of practice standards such as the use of silver- alloy catheters, education of the nursing staff to prevent tube kinking and maintenance drainage have often been mentioned by different authors as possible alternatives of reducing the rate of infection of CAUTI. Despite the recommendation that the above strategies can play an important role in reducing the infection of CAUTI, research show that inconsistency in practicing the interventions is one of the main reasons why they do not bear fruits CITATION Hun17 \l 1033 (Hung, 2017).
As an intervention to reduce CAUTI, we suggest the use of the bundled approach intervention. According to Blanck et al (2014), bundled approach is the process of carrying out all the elements of care at the same time with the guidance of a checklist to make sure that each element of care has been included.
